Understanding the Master Number 11 in Numerology
In the context of the provided texts, numerology is defined as the study of the mystical significance of numbers and their influence on human affairs. The calculation method for determining the vibration of a home involves summing the digits of the address. For example, a house numbered 434 would be calculated as 4 + 3 + 4 = 11. The documentation explicitly states that when the result is 11, 22, or 33, it is not reduced further. These are classified as "Master Numbers."
The number 11 is specifically linked to the ruling influence of the Moon (derived from 1 + 1 = 2) and carries the spiritual influence of Uranus. This combination creates a dynamic energy that emphasizes illumination and psychic sensitivity. The sources describe house number 11 as a "channel" or a "portal" to higher awareness. Residents of such a home are believed to be more receptive to insights and may find that activities such as meditation, prayer, and creative expression are naturally supported by the home's energetic signature.
The positive vibrations associated with this number include: * Intuition and Spiritual Insight: A heightened ability to connect with inner wisdom. * Idealism and Inspiration: An environment that supports visionary thinking. * Creativity and Empathy: A space conducive to artistic endeavors and emotional connection. * Harmonious Relationships: The number 11 combines the energies of partnership (2), encouraging compassion and flow within the household.
It is noted that while this number fosters a slow-paced, deep connection to life, it may feel restrictive to those who are highly ambitious in a purely material sense. The energy encourages depth over speed, and spiritual alignment over rapid accumulation of wealth.
Holistic Elements and Feng Shui Correlations
While the primary focus of the provided data is numerology, the documentation includes references to Feng Shui elements and colors that correspond to the vibration of house number 11. These correlations are presented as methods to enhance the positive energies inherent in the address.
The sources identify the Feng Shui element associated with house number 11 as Water. Water represents flow, wisdom, and emotional depth, which aligns with the intuitive nature of the number 11. To harmonize the space, the documentation suggests utilizing specific colors that resonate with this vibration. These include Silver, Pearl White, Soft Lavender, Indigo, and Sky Blue. Incorporating these colors within the home is believed to support the energetic qualities of the number.
Regarding spatial orientation, the sources mention North-West as a lucky direction for house number 11. In Feng Shui, the North-West sector of a home is traditionally associated with helpful people and travel, but in this specific context, it is highlighted as beneficial for the unique vibrations of the number 11.
